Corporal Marc-Anthony Diplacido, a water support technician with Combat Logistics Battalion 7, monitors a water pump system during a daily inspection aboard Camp Dwyer, Helmand province, Afghanistan, July 21, 2014. Water support technician Marines produce approximately 50,000 gallons of water each day to support coalition forces stationed aboard Camp Dwyer. (U.S. Marine Corps photo by Cpl. Cody Haas/ Released)
